Privacy Dilemma: The 'Double-Edged Sword' of Blockchain
Currently, blockchain technology is facing an awkward situation: anyone can view the transaction records on the chain, which guarantees transparency but also means that the financial privacy of individuals and institutions has nowhere to hide. Imagine that every transaction you make is clearly visible to strangers, which deters many potential users. The emergence of Boundless aims to solve this problem.
Technical Core: The Wonderful Application of Zero-Knowledge Proofs
What stands out most about Boundless is its use of zero-knowledge proof technology. Simply put, this technology allows you to prove that you possess certain information without having to disclose the specific content of that information. It's like being able to prove to others that you know a secret without having to reveal the secret itself. This mechanism ensures both the verifiability of transactions and the security of privacy.
